Key Point Details
Celebration of Sobriety Vice President JD Vance celebrated his mother, Beverly Aikins, achieving 10 years of sobriety.
Significance of Addiction Vance’s mother’s addiction impacted his childhood, inspiring him to share her story in his book.
Celebration Event The White House hosted a celebration attended by family and friends in honor of Aikins’ milestone.
Message of Inspiration Vance emphasized Aikins as an inspiration to others in recovery, stating she is now dependable and reliable.
Current Role Aikins now works as a nurse at Seacrest Recovery Center, helping others facing addiction.
Expert Advice Aikins encourages those with substance abuse problems to seek help and emphasizes that recovery is possible.
